MPV17 Activators encompass a range of chemical compounds that indirectly influence the functional activity of MPV17 through various mitochondrial pathways. The polyphenolic compound Resveratrol, and the antidiabetic drug Metformin, initiate cellular mechanisms that culminate in the enhancement of mitochondrial biogenesis and function, thereby indirectly supporting the mitochondrial maintenance roles attributed to MPV17. The importance of mitochondrial health in MPV17 functionality is further underscored by the actions of NAD+, which upregulates sirtuin activity, and Pioglitazone, a PPAR-gamma agonist that maintains mitochondrial morphology. The involvement of MPV17 in mitochondrial DNA protection is complemented by Leucine's activation of mTOR signaling, leading to increased mitochondrial biogenesis, and Coenzyme Q10, which is essential for the electron transport chain, thereby upholding mitochondrial membrane potential and integrity.
Additionally, compounds like Alpha-lipoic acid and Creatine provide a supportive environment for MPV17's action by enhancing mitochondrial energy metabolism and cellular energy reserves, respectively. The cellular longevity molecule Spermidine, through the promotion of autophagy, indirectly contributes to the enhancement of MPV17 activity by ensuring mitochondrial quality control. The PPAR activator Bezafibrate boosts fatty acid oxidation within mitochondria, complementing MPV17's role in the organelle. Nicotinamide riboside, by boosting NAD+ levels, and Epicatechin, through its stimulatory effect on mitochondrial biogenesis, also contribute to the functional support of MPV17, emphasizing the intricacy and interconnectedness of mitochondrial health and MPV17's role in maintaining it.
